Ndata access patterns pdf

These patterns concentrate on improving data access performance and resource utilizations by eliminating redundant data access operations. Snippets our free sewing tips are delivered directly to your inbox in bitesize chunks. To this day, there is a common agreement around the concerns that a designer faces. One approach could be to use a pattern language, an idea which has been successful in fields as diverse as town planning and software engineering. In a nutshell, the dao knows which data source that could be a database, a flat file or even a webservice to connect to and is specific for this data source e. Antony unwin1 abstract how do you carry out data analysis. Amazon web services provides several database options to support modern datadriven apps and software frameworks to make developing against them easy. Implement concurrency and transactions more effectively and reliably. In general, i second john nolans recommendation of patterns of enterprise application architecture. Pcs, that are associated with the instruction that generated each of the cache miss addresses.

Rope elastic, beading cord elastic will work you may also us 18 flat elastic. Thank you for all the love you have shown the 6day kid blanket. Data access patterns demystifies techniques that have traditionally been used only in the most robust data access solutionsmaking those techniques. Start out using these patterns now and avoid a lot of pain later. To fill a closed shape with a hatch pattern, use a hatchbrush object. Design pattern questions on data access layer dofactory. Putting the data lake to work a guide to best practices cito research advancing the craft of technology leadership 2 oo to perform new types of data processing oo to perform single subject analytics based on very speciic use cases the irst examples of data lake implementations were created to handle web data at orga.

Design patterns for largescale database management. Additionally data access patterns should also be analyzed across application use cases to understand data access logic to be able to. Significant expertise exists in cots formats including vpx, vme, cpci, xmc, fmc, pci, pmc and. I have a set of data from 51 subjects for 7 days continuous. This pattern ensures that the class has only one instance and provides a global point of access to it. Data patterns, with years of knowledge and experience in reliable hardware engineering, can offer design and development services for high precision analog, high speed digital, mixed signal and rf design, from elementary boards to highend complex systems. More specifically, i would always recommend that you hide your data access layer behind an interface and use dependency injection to inject a particular data access component into your domain logic at runtime. And i even flipped them for lefties here graphs for those who have asked for them are here join the facebook group for people making the 6day kid blanket im available to help answer questions on my facebook page. Data access operations are a common source of bottlenecks as they consume a significant portion of a systems memory.

Cache is one of the most important resources of modern cpus. And now, thanks to a fantastic online collection of vintage sewing patterns, its time to dust off your sewing machine. It includes code samples and general advice on using each pattern. We support 8 harmonic patterns, 9 chart patterns and. One important part of the data access patterns is the data reuse distance histogram of each array in a gpu kernel. Game programming patterns is a collection of patterns i found in games that make code cleaner, easier to understand, and faster. Over 83,500 vintage sewing patterns are now available online. Performance antipatterns in databasedriven applications. Patterns for data analysis are defined and discussed, illustrated with. More specifically, i would always recommend that you hide your data access layer behind an interface and use dependency injection to inject a particular data access component into. The only thing you may wish to add to this is a data access. I hope your blankets keep you and your loved ones warm for years and years. Pattern hacks look through all the free hacks from seamwork magazine and use them to customize our patterns or any other pattern in your stash.

My entities i know caseof is strange name, it makes sense in the context of the app. The first concern for a database schema, introduced at the. Pdf exploiting memory access patterns to improve memory. The increased programmability of gpu hardware, along. The vintage patterns wiki boasts more than 83,500 patterns that are at least 25 years old, which makes for a fascinating look back at fashion history. Efficient data access is key to a highperforming application. Analyzing data relevance and access patterns of live production.

All further references to objects of the singleton class refer to the same underlying instance. Each column in data is a follows attached image is a sample of data. This guide contains twentyfour design patterns and ten related guidance topics that articulate the benefits of applying patterns by showing how each piece can fit into the big picture of cloud application architectures. Presents a data model that uses references to describe onetomany relationships between documents. Data access object interface this interface defines the standard operations to be performed on a model objects. Harmonic scanner pattern recognition stock, forex and crypto. However, most of the patterns are relevant to any distributed system.

Youll find free patterns for crochet, knitting, sewing, quilting, crossstitch, plastic canvas, beading and more. In some cases, it is possible to access the data of a system or the database plan cache i. Designing objectoriented software is hard, and designing reusable. Data access pattern an overview sciencedirect topics. In this talk we will present a halfdozen design patterns for database management to help implement 24x7 applications that handle 100s of terabytes spread over multiple continents on databases like mysql.

Sections 46 present three applications of these ideas. Patterns of data modeling emerging directions in database systems and applications series editor sham navathe profe. Understanding data characteristics and access patterns in a cloud. The data lake pattern is also ideal for medium data and little data too. The hardware development team develops architectures and detailed schematics for board level products. Database interactions in objectoriented applications paperback clifton nock on. How to make a face mask what you will need cotton fabric, a pretty print is best. The most common of these is the abstract interface design as already shown by jeff foster. Most of the patterns include code samples or snippets that show how to implement the pattern on azure. When i want to manipulate with data in database, access them through repository, which uses these dao objects to manipulate single objects. Drums in drum sheet music the various drum elements are represented by a rounded note.

For example, customer information, such as name and address from a policy holder, as in the example mentioned above, might be stored in a single table in one database and in multiple tables in another database. This argues for adding a second entity address, as shown in figure 3. Information aggregation and data integration with db2 information integrator nagraj alur yunjung chang barry devlin bill mathews john matthews sreeram potukuchi uday sai kumar information aggregation and data integration patterns db2 information integration architecture overview customer insight scenario front cover. Reviewing data access patterns and computational redundancy. This is the book i wish i had when i started making games, and now i want you to have it. Get unlimited access to the best stories on medium and support writers while youre at it. Machine learning pattern recognition we provide charting with pattern recognition algorithm for global equity, forex, cryptocurrency and futures. Best practice software engineering data access object.

Enter your email for a free copy of my oslo craft bag sewing pattern, an exclusive pattern just for my followers. Whenever and wherever you feel the itch to stitch, you can easily log in to your all access membership to knit and crochet now. Have poco entities, for each entity have dao object. A secure processor must verify the integrity of data stored offchip. Every episode and every pattern is at your fingertips on your computer, tablet or smartphone. Patterns should address the fundamental concerns around the design of a database schema. Model tree structures with parent references presents a data model that organizes documents in a treelike structure by storing references to parent nodes in child nodes. Is the data access layer in spark sample project secured enough for sql injection and how to replace it with stored procedure hi all, i would like to ask about the spark data access layer of. Performance anti patterns in databasedriven applications.

Everyday low prices and free delivery on eligible orders. Data access component and the factory design pattern. Characterizing database users access patterns springerlink. Successful database applications do not happen by accident. The following example demonstrates how to fill an ellipse with a hatch pattern. The layer of a dbms that is focusing mainly on data access and not so much on. Yarnspirations has everything you need for a great project. The data federation pattern requires the mapping of data elements from various data sources that are within the scope of the integrated view. Each pattern describes the problem that the pattern addresses, considerations for applying the pattern, and an example based on microsoft azure. Optimize data structures and memory access patterns to.

Pcs are unique tags, that is each pc is unique to a particular instruction that has been compiled from a particular function in a particular code. Following are the participants in data access object pattern. Search find a specific article, pattern hack, or technique. Here, each address must be the location of one and only one party. Goptimize data structures and memory access patterns to improve data locality pdf 782kb. Data access object pattern or dao pattern is used to separate low level data accessing api or operations from high level business services. Each note position corresponds to a specific drum set element. Database interactions in objectoriented applications paperback software patterns paperback 1 by clifton nock isbn.

How to make an adult mask with ties supplies for 1 mask. Each party, in turn, may be at one or more addresses. We use user access patterns to describe how a client application or a group of users accesses the data of a database system. Putting the data lake to work a guide to best practices. Snare drum tom i tom 2 tom 3 tom 4 bass drum cymbals closed hihat in drum sheet music cymbals and hihat are represented by a xshaped note. The pattern ensures that only one object of a specific class is ever created. The singleton design pattern is one of the simplest design patterns. Bags if youre new here, you may want to sign up for my newsletter which includes new pattern releases and fabric sales. Intel sgx uses a small hash for each data block and an integrity tree over the counters used by.

695 960 1077 1598 911 845 309 1098 78 666 606 1433 1323 108 536 1176 973 1598 1404 111 142 135 683 693 94 945 839 369 695 461 1261 1036 1384 1140 941 1071 164 873 621